Monsta X’s Hyungwon to Reconnect with Fans at ‘Wonder Garden’ After Military Discharge

Hyungwon of Monsta X reconnects with fans at Wonder Garden following military service

Hyungwon of K-pop powerhouse Monsta X is making a heartfelt return with his first official schedule post-military service—a free fan event titled ‘Wonder Garden’. Hosted by Starship Entertainment, the event is dedicated to ‘Monbebe’—Monsta X’s cherished fanbase—and will take place on February 17 at the Myeonghwa Live Hall in Yeongdeungpo-gu, Seoul.

The fan event will hold two sessions: one at 1 PM and another at 5 PM, providing an intimate setting for Hyungwon to interact directly with his supporters. Only members of Monbebe’s 8th term will be granted access, with tickets available through Interpark starting from February 12 at 7 PM KST. Admission for all seats will be free of charge.

Hyungwon, who enlisted on November 14, 2023, is set to be officially discharged on February 13, 2025. Remarkably, his “Wonder Garden” fan meet is scheduled just four days after his discharge, marking a sentimental and personal gesture towards fans who have awaited his return.

Since debuting with Monsta X in 2015, Hyungwon has established himself as a multi-faceted entertainer. His contributions span across genres as a vocalist, actor, DJ, producer, and host. Starting with his self-produced track ‘Nobody Else’ in 2020, Hyungwon continued to showcase his music-making prowess in Monsta X albums.

In 2023, he teamed up with fellow Monsta X member Shownu to form the group’s first sub-unit Shownu X Hyungwon. Together, they co-wrote and co-composed tracks including ‘Love Me a Little’ and ‘Roll With Me’, further solidifying Hyungwon’s status as a “DIY idol.”

Beyond music, Hyungwon captivated fans with his solo web variety show ‘Brother, Where Are You?’ and made notable guest appearances in web content like Lee Yeong-ji’s talk show ‘I Haven’t Done Anything, But…’. His charming personality and refined manners made headlines and drew new fans to the Monsta X fandom.

Additionally, Hyungwon captured attention as a host, notably as a DJ on ‘Idol Radio Season 2’ and a co-MC on SBS’s ‘Inkigayo’. His dynamic role as a presenter will continue when he appears at the Asia Star Entertainer Awards 2025 on February 29.

Coinciding with Hyungwon’s discharge, Monsta X will celebrate their 10th anniversary on February 14, further amplifying the significance of his return.
